PH, EU Discuss South China Sea Concerns and Maritime Cooperation.

Manila: Opposition to unilateral actions in the West Philippine Sea and ways to increase maritime cooperation, including through coast guards, were at the core of discussions in a Philippine-European Union maritime dialogue this week. The Philippines and the EU convened the 2nd Sub-Committee Meeting (SCM) on Maritime Cooperation in Manila on Oct. 29, which builds on the accomplishments of the inaugural SCM in Brussels last year. DOH Implements ‘Code White’ Alert Across Hospitals for Undas Weekend.

Manila: The Department of Health (DOH) has raised a ‘Code White Alert’ in all hospitals nationwide, indicating the highest level of preparedness to handle medical emergencies during the long weekend. According to Philippines News Agency, Health Assistant Secretary Albert Domingo announced on “Special Report: Undas 2024,” organized by the Presidential Communications Office, that the Code White Alert will remain in effect until November 2. This alert status ensures that hospitals are ready to address any medical emergencies, with all health professionals and personnel on standby. Travel Now as NLEX, SLEX Vehicular Traffic Unusually Low: TRB.

Manila: The Toll Regulatory Board (TRB) has called on the public who plan to leave Metro Manila during the long Undas weekend to take advantage of the low vehicular traffic along the North Luzon Expressway (NLEX) and South Luzon Expressway (SLEX).
